What do?

Adds damage reactions to virtually all combatants in the game (INCLUDING XCOM!)

If you’re familiar with A Better ADVENT’s prime reactions, it’s like that, but the actual actions that can be taken are a lot more restricted here.

You can only perform:
Quick Hunker: provides smaller bonuses than hunker down.
Prepare: provides a small amount of aim and crit for your upcoming turn, but can be lost if you take damage again.
Quick Fortify: restricted to units who can’t take cover. Provides the same bonuses as quick hunker, but the effect can be weakened and eventually removed as the unit takes damage
Standard move: a single yellow move. Might actually be the strongest out of all of these imo. You can now modify certain aspects of this ability. Go check out XComDamageReactions.ini

All of these can be tinkered with (and even disabled) in the config.

Is compatible?

Strangely, more than I thought. In fact, default config settings will enable SYNERGY with some other reactions from other mods, like prime reactions from A BETTER ADVENT. In that specific scenario, they will do their prime reaction, and THEN do their damage reaction from this mod.

New update adds a config option that should enable synergies with other prime reaction mods. Set TRIGGER_METHOD in XComDamageReactions.ini to ELD_OnVisualizationBlockCompleted if you want to make that happen. I only tested it a little bit and haven’t done a full campaign with it though, so keep that in mind. Let me know if you run into any bugs with that setting.
